Amy Bonitatibus

Amy Bonitatibus, Chief Communications Officer at Wells Fargo, boasts a diverse career in marketing and communications. She transitioned from Capitol Hill to Wall Street, ascending to senior roles in major organizations.

Most recently, at JPMorgan Chase, she led significant initiatives, notably as Chief Marketing Officer for Home Lending, achieving record volumes and brand ratings. Her influence extended to high-impact public relations campaigns, including the successful launches of Freedom Unlimited and Sapphire Reserve credit cards, the latter gaining recognition in The Wall Street Journal.

Prior roles at Fannie Mae and as a press secretary for Senator Hillary Clinton shaped her expertise. Currently, Amy oversees a skilled team at Wells Fargo, focusing on brand reputation, employee engagement, and innovative branding strategies. She holds degrees from Georgetown University and the Georgetown Public Policy Institute.
